A new billboard campaign in New York state aims to eliminate lead poisoning. The “Renovate Right” campaign targets homeowners and tenants who may be revamping a property with pre-1978 lead based paint.  The campaign involves ads on more than 60 billboards throughout the city of Buffalo and Erie County.  The ads will rotate around the area through January, but they began by kicking off “Lead Poisoning Week” back in October.

Billboards are just a part of the marketing campaign, which also includes brochures that will be distributed to local community centers, hardware stores and block clubs.  The campaign was unveiled by Buffalo’s mayor, who was joined by Erie County executives and representatives from the Community Foundation for Greater Buffalo.  A partnership between the three entities was formed back in May of 2016.
